Why Home Lighting Matters More Than Ever

Residential LEDs — especially ENERGY STAR-rated products — use at least 75% less energy, and last up to 25 times longer, than incandescent lighting. This dramatic efficiency improvement means your lighting choices now impact both your monthly utility bills and your home’s environmental footprint.

Good lighting affects everything from your mood and productivity to your home’s resale value. Installing smart devices in your home can increase its resale value by up to 5%. Beyond financial benefits, proper illumination enhances safety, reduces eye strain, and creates atmospheres that support your daily activities.

Smart Lighting Technology Revolution

The Smart Lighting Market is expected to reach USD 22.98 billion in 2025 and grow at a CAGR of 19.77% to reach USD 56.63 billion by 2030. This explosive growth reflects how homeowners are embracing connected lighting solutions that offer unprecedented control and convenience.

Smart lighting systems allow you to control brightness, color temperature, and scheduling through your smartphone or voice commands. You can create custom scenes for different activities, automatically adjust lighting based on natural daylight, and even sync your lights with your music or television.

Key Smart Features to Consider

Voice Control Integration: Most smart lighting works with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ple HomeKit, making it easy to adjust lights without reaching for a switch.

Scheduling and Automation: Set your lights to gradually brighten in the morning or dim in the evening to support natural sleep patterns.

Energy Monitoring: Track your electricity usage and see real-time savings compared to traditional bulbs.

Remote Access: Control your home’s lighting from anywhere, perfect for security or coming home to a well-lit house.

Energy Efficiency That Actually Saves Money

LEDs are clearly the most efficient option, using up to 90% less energy than traditional incandescent bulbs and 50-60% less than CFLs to produce the same amount of light. For the average household, this translates to hundreds of dollars in annual savings.

A single smart light bulb costs $15, but a full home lighting upgrade can cost up to $3,000, according to Angi. While the upfront investment might seem substantial, most homeowners recover these costs within two to three years through energy savings alone.

Real-World Savings Examples

Room Type Traditional Bulbs Annual Cost LED Annual Cost Annual Savings
Living Room (6 bulbs) $184 $37 $147
Kitchen (8 bulbs) $245 $49 $196
Bedrooms (4 bulbs) $122 $24 $98
Total Home $551 $110 $441

By 2035, the majority of lighting installations are anticipated to use LED technology, and energy savings from LED lighting could top 569 TWh annually by 2035, equal to the annual energy output of more than 92 1,000 MW power plants.

Room-by-Room Lighting Solutions

Living Room Ambiance

Your living room needs flexible lighting that works for everything from movie nights to dinner parties. Layer different light sources to create depth and visual interest.

Ambient Lighting: Use overhead fixtures or recessed lights for general illumination. Dimmable options let you adjust brightness throughout the day.

Task Lighting: Add reading lamps near seating areas and accent lights to highlight artwork or architectural features.

Accent Lighting: During the day, maximize the use of natural light by installing sheer curtains or blinds that allow sunlight to filter through. This not only illuminates your living room but also creates a warm and inviting atmosphere.

Kitchen Functionality

The most important and unexpected lampscaping trend for the coming year is the kitchen countertop lighting trend which encourages you to add a small lamp to a kitchen side or open shelves to introduce a softer, ambient light.

Kitchens require bright, focused lighting for food preparation and cooking safety. Under-cabinet LED strips eliminate shadows on countertops, while pendant lights over islands provide both task lighting and visual appeal.

Bedroom Comfort

Incorporate a combination of task lighting, such as bedside lamps, and overhead lighting, like a stylish chandelier, to create the desired ambiance in your bedroom. Choose warmer color temperatures (2700K-3000K) to promote relaxation and better sleep quality.

Bathroom Safety and Style

Bathroom lighting must balance functionality with moisture resistance. Use IP-rated fixtures near showers and tubs, and install adequate lighting around mirrors for grooming tasks.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much can I save by switching to LED lighting?

Residential LEDs use at least 75% less energy than incandescent lighting, typically saving $400-600 annually for average homes.

Do smart bulbs work with existing fixtures?

Yes, most smart bulbs are designed as direct replacements for standard bulbs and work with existing fixtures and switches.

What’s the best color temperature for different rooms?

Use warm light (2700K-3000K) for bedrooms and living areas, neutral white (3500K-4000K) for kitchens, and cool white (5000K+) for workspaces.

How long do LED bulbs actually last?

With a typical lifespan of 25,000-50,000 hours (and high-quality models reaching 100,000 hours), LEDs substantially outperform incandescent (1,000 hours) and other traditional options.

Can outdoor smart lighting withstand weather conditions?

Modern outdoor smart lighting fixtures are built with weather-resistant materials and IP65 or higher ratings for water and dust protection.
